Learning programming for children is an enjoyable and beneficial journey in the modern world of technology. Through elmadrasah.com platform, your children can learn programming in a simplified and entertaining way. It’s a leading educational platform that uses the latest techniques and teaching methods to ensure an exciting and effective learning experience.

Benefits of learning programming

Teaching programming to children provides them with the opportunity to develop various essential cognitive and developmental skills.

Here are some benefits that learning programming can achieve for children:

  • Enhances creative thinking

Learning programming encourages children to think creatively and come up with innovative solutions to problems.

By writing code and creating programs, their imagination and creative abilities are stimulated.

  • Develops computer skills

Learning programming helps in developing computer usage skills and understanding how programs and applications work.

These skills are fundamental in the era of technology and contribute to preparing them for the future job market.

  • Enhances problem-solving skills 

Learning programming teaches children how to analyze and break down problems into smaller solvable parts.

They also learn critical thinking skills, testing ideas, and applying alternative solutions.

  • Improves focus and patience

Children learn focus and patience through programming as they need to concentrate for extended periods to solve problems and create complex programs.

How programming learning enhances creative thinking and computer skills

  • Building creative projects: When children learn computer programming, they have the opportunity to build creative projects of their own, such as creating computer games or mobile applications. They learn how to realize their ideas and implement them independently.
  • Promotes collaboration and teamwork: Learning programming encourages children to work in teams, exchange ideas, and leverage each other’s strengths. They learn communication and collaboration skills to achieve common goals.
  • Develops analytical skills: When writing code and creating programs, children need to think methodically and analytically. They learn how to understand a problem, devise a plan to solve it, and apply appropriate steps to complete the project.

In short, learning programming contributes to developing a wide range of cognitive and developmental skills in children. It’s an enjoyable journey with the elmadrasah.com platform, which provides an interactive and entertaining learning environment for programming.

Importance of learning programming for preparing children for the digital age and the future job market

Learning programming is a fundamental skill in the era of digitization and the future job market.

It contributes to preparing children for the job market and increases their chances of success in the future:

  • Develops critical thinking skills: Children learn critical thinking and problem-solving skills through programming. They learn how to break down large problems into smaller tasks and solve them step by step.
  • Enhances collaboration and teamwork: Learning programming encourages children to collaborate and work in teams. They learn how to communicate, divide tasks, and work together to achieve a shared goal.
  • Develops information technology skills: Learning programming contributes to developing technology skills in children. They learn how to use smart devices, web applications, and coding programs, enhancing their understanding of technology and enabling them to innovate in this field.

By providing a fun and interactive learning platform, elmadrasah.com offers children the opportunity to learn programming and acquire the necessary skills to succeed in the digital age and the future job market.

Elmadrasah.com platform and educational programs

Elmadrasah.com platform offers educational programs ranging from beginner to advanced levels in various programming languages such as Python, Java, and Scratch.

The platform includes interactive and enjoyable lessons along with practical exercises that help children develop their programming skills.

Some of the key advantages that children gain when learning programming through the elmadrasah.com platform include:

  • Simplified and Easy Learning: The platform uses simple and engaging teaching methods to make the learning process enjoyable and effective.
  • Interactive Lessons: Children learn through interactive lessons and direct explanations from experts in the programming field.
  • Progress Tracking: The platform provides detailed progress reports on children’s programming learning journey.
  • Technical Support: A dedicated technical support team is available to answer any queries or issues children may face during their learning.

By using elmadrasah.com platform, you ensure a fun and beneficial learning journey for your children in the world of programming.

Elmadrasah.com Courses

Learning programming for children is an exciting and crucial challenge in this digital age.

Through elmadrasah.com platform, children can embark on an enjoyable and engaging learning journey to explore the world of programming and develop technological skills.

Children can choose from a wide range of courses suitable for their ages and needs.

Whether they are beginners in programming or have some experience, the platform offers:

  • Courses to help them learn operating systems, accounting applications, gaming apps, and other programming skills.
  • Elmadrasah.com platform offers educational courses in programming for children aged 4 to 10. This platform employs educational games to make the learning process enjoyable and engaging for children.
  • Various courses cover a range of topics, such as learning programming languages, game development, website and app creation, and more. These courses are taught interactively and in a manner suitable for children.
  • Through elmadrasah.com, children can learn and enhance their programming skills exceptionally. Upon completing training courses, children receive certificates that boost their confidence, motivating them to pursue further learning and development.

Whether you seek to enhance your child’s technology capabilities or facilitate their access to future job opportunities, elmadrasah.com courses are the ideal choice to achieve these goals.

Experience learning programming with elmadrasah.com:

Elmadrasah.com platform offers an enjoyable and innovative learning experience for teaching programming to children.

With its user-friendly interface and interactive activities, children learn programming concepts in exciting and entertaining ways.

  • Coding Play: Elmadrasah.com employs simplified and interactive teaching methods, making children feel like they’re playing instead of attending traditional lessons. Children learn how to build programs and create games by playing with code.
  • Interactive Storytelling: elmadrasah.com introduces an innovative approach where children can create their own interactive stories and animations. This helps them develop programming skills and creative thinking.
  • Hands-on Projects: The elmadrasah.com system encourages children to undertake hands-on projects in the programming field. They learn to apply concepts and skills they’ve acquired to real projects, such as creating their own applications and games.
  • Competition and Motivation: Elmadrasah.com platform provides a competitive environment that motivates children to excel in programming. Children can share their creations and compete with others to achieve more accomplishments.
  • Choosing the Right Program: Before delving into teaching children programming, it’s important to choose a program that suits their needs and abilities. Elmadrasah.com offers specialized programs designed for children, making it easier for them to understand concepts and skills.
  • Leveraging Additional Resources: In addition to elmadrasah.com platform, you can utilize extra resources like books and online educational videos to enhance children’s understanding and education in various programming aspects.

By utilizing elmadrasah.com platform, the journey of learning programming becomes both enjoyable and stimulating for children, enhancing their skills and nurturing their creativity in the programming world.

